Understanding the Time Zones
Sydney, the bustling capital of New South Wales, Australia, operates on Australian Eastern Standard Time (AEST), which is UTC+10 during standard time and UTC+11 during daylight saving time. On the other hand, Beijing, the heart of China, follows China Standard Time (CST), which is UTC+8 year-round.
This means that when it’s 12 PM in Sydney, it’s 10 AM in Beijing. During daylight saving time in Sydney, the gap widens by one hour, making it 9 AM in Beijing when it’s 12 PM in Sydney. Knowing this difference is crucial for coordinating activities or business meetings across these two cities.
Why the Time Difference Matters
The time difference between Sydney and Beijing is significant for several reasons. For travelers, understanding the time difference helps plan flights and ensure you arrive well-rested. For businesses, it’s essential for scheduling meetings that accommodate both parties’ work hours. And for casual communication, knowing the time difference ensures you don’t call someone in the middle of the night!
For example, if you’re in Sydney and want to schedule a call with a colleague in Beijing, you might choose a time that works for both of you. If you propose a meeting at 3 PM Sydney time, it would be 1 PM Beijing time, which is likely a good time for both parties to connect.
